Requirements


Must have:

We are looking for an individual with over 5 years of experience in Information Security or IT, including at least 2 years focused on Identity and Access Management (IAM). The ideal candidate will possess strong hands-on experience with Azure Active Directory (Azure AD) and familiarity with ticketing systems such as ServiceNow or JIRA for IAM requests and incident management. You should have a demonstrated background in user provisioning, account management, and access monitoring. Excellent technical writing skills for documenting policies, procedures, and workflows are essential. A basic understanding of automation concepts like scripting and workflow tools, along with knowledge of authentication methods (e.g., MFA) and access governance, is also required. Strong communication abilities to collaborate effectively across teams are necessary, as well as a forward-thinking attitude with a desire to enhance monitoring and reporting capabilities. We value individuals who are highly accountable, adaptable, and detail-oriented, especially in a dynamic working environment.

Responsibilities:


In this role, I will manage and efficiently resolve IAM service requests and incidents through the ticketing system. I will oversee user provisioning and de-provisioning in Azure AD and Okta, ensuring that access aligns with our policies and meets business requirements. Moreover, I will write and maintain clear procedures, documentation, and user guides to support consistent IAM operations. I will strive to improve ongoing IAM processes, including password management, multi-factor authentication (MFA), access reviews, and entitlement management. Identifying opportunities for automation to decrease manual labor and boost efficiency is a key part of my role, as is collaborating with IT and Security teams to enhance the monitoring and reporting of IAM activities. I will assist with both internal and external audit requests by gathering necessary documentation and providing informed responses. I will actively contribute to continuous improvement by suggesting process enhancements and adopting industry best practices. Additionally, I will provide guidance and training to junior staff on IAM policies, tools, and procedures.
